MIR 2015
The Main Topics in 2015 Will be
-- Multiprofessional Organisation of Radiology Departments-- Training and Education for Residents in Radiology
-- Auditing and Peer Review – Value for Improving Quality and Safety
-- Economics in Radiology – organization and technical operations
-- Hand-off sessions for relevant Management Tools
-- Radiology 3.0 – views on Radiology´s future from European and US-Perspective
